Rolly Romero makes a very direct plea amid rumors of a possible rematch with Ryan Garcia

After Rolando "Rolly" Romero's surprise victory over Ryan Garcia on May 2, 2025 in New York, rumors of a rematch between the two have been growing. Rolly Romero lashes out at Devin Haney amid Ryan Garcia doping chaos

The rivalry between Rolando 'Rolly' Romero and Devin Haney has gone from sporting to personal. After Haney's lackluster performance against Jose Ramirez in New York, Romero has taken every opportunity to question the legacy and credibility of the former undefeated champion. The situation escalated even further after it was confirmed that Haney's fight against Ryan Garcia was annulled due to the Californian's use of banned substances.Instead of showing solidarity with Haney for being the victim of a doped rival, Romero doubled down on his taunts. In a live broadcast, he mocked: "Did the substances really make Devin not able to keep his hand up?" suggesting that not even Garcia's doping justifies Haney's poor performance in the ring. Rolando Romero makes drastic decision after his million-dollar victory over Ryan Garcia: “The old Rolly is dead”

Rolando "Rolly" Romero's image as an irreverent provocateur was left behind on May 2, 2025, when he not only defeated Ryan Garcia against all odds, but also showed a side unknown to many. Far from the arrogance that characterized him, the 29-year-old boxer revealed a moment of vulnerability after the fight: "Just when I got into my truck, I sat down and also cried". His comment was not a criticism, but an act of empathy towards Garcia, who was harshly criticized on social media for showing his emotions after the defeat.Romero knows what it is like to fall and be the target of ridicule.
